Even More Amazing & Extraordinary Rlwy Facts

Even More Amazing and Extraordinary Railway Facts is another fascinating miscellany that will delight railway buffs everywhere. More fun and interesting trivia for the railway buff from the famous steam trains that puffed across the British countryside to long forgotten journeys to interesting facts about the history of the railways. Travel back to the age of steam before becoming up-to-date with railways today. In addition to the fascinating lists of railway trivia such as longest tunnels, widest bridges and most powerful locomotives, discover more about the crucial role railways and train travel have played in the history of Britain. From the sublime to the ridiculous and the euphoric to the poignant, every railway enthusiast is catered for. Brief accessible and entertaining pieces on
a wide variety of subjects makes it the perfect book to dip in to.About the AuthorJulian Holland has always had a passion for British railways and has documented his many journeys around Britain during the final years of steam. He has worked in the publishing industry for the last 39 years, coupling his work with his passion on many occasions, for titles such as Along Lost Lines, Tickets Please! and Amazing and Extraordinary Railway Facts.
